China & U.S. Trade Talks in London: Progress Made? 🌏💼

China & U.S. Trade Talks in London: Progress Made? 🌏💼

Chinese Vice Commerce Minister Li Chenggang described recent trade discussions between China and the U.S. as 'substantive and candid,' sparking optimism among global markets. The two-day talks in London focused on economic cooperation, with both sides engaging in what Li called 'professional and reasonable' dialogue. 🗣️✨

While details remain under wraps, the meetings signal a potential thaw in cross-Pacific trade relations. Analysts say the discussions could pave the way for eased tariffs or tech restrictions—key issues impacting everything from smartphone prices to EV supply chains. 📱🔋
